When allocating a mempool which is larger than the largest
available area, it can take a lot of time:
a- the mempool calculate the required memory size, and tries
to allocate it, it fails
b- then it tries to allocate the largest available area (this
does not request new huge pages)
c- add this zone to the mempool, this triggers the allocation
of a mem hdr, which request a new huge page
d- back to a- until mempool is populated or until there is no
more memory
This can take a lot of time to finally fail (several minutes): in step
a- it takes all available hugepages on the system, then release them
after it fails.
The problem appeared with commit eba11e364614 ("mempool: reduce wasted
space on populate"), because smaller chunks are now allowed. Previously,
it had to be at least one page size, which is not the case in step b-.
To fix this, implement our own way to allocate the largest available
area instead of using the feature from memzone: if an allocation fails,
try to divide the size by 2 and retry. When the requested size falls
below min_chunk_size, stop and return an error.
